Ordinals
beta
Sat 1488752971649516
decimal
50688.724171649516
percentile
2.977505943299032%
name
mepskplxblon
cycle
0
epoch
2
block
50688
offset
724171649516
timestamp
2024-02-04 13:13:50 UTC
rarity
common
prev
next